How to Simply Integrate E-Sign APIs

Implementing E-Sign APIs can simplify document signing workflows for organizations, enhancing efficiency and reducing turnaround times. To get started, companies should evaluate their particular demands and pick an API that suits their purposes. Popular options include DocuSign, Adobe Sign, and HelloSign, each offering distinct features.

Furthermore, developers can leverage the documentation provided by the API, which commonly features sample code and implementation guides. By using RESTful web APIs, companies can seamlessly integrate their existing systems, such as CRMs or document management platforms. Integrating robust authentication protocols, like OAuth protocols, helps keep data safeguarded throughout all transactions.

Testing the integration in a sandbox environment helps companies to address potential challenges before launching. Additionally, educating employees on the updated platform can maximize user adoption and optimize workflows. By following these steps, companies can seamlessly incorporate E-Sign APIs and greatly enhance their document management workflows.

Boosting Data Security and Compliance Via E-Sign APIs?

Incorrect. The integration of E-Sign APIs greatly strengthens security measures and regulatory compliance for businesses. Such APIs employ robust encryption standards to secure sensitive information during transfer, making certain that documents are kept private and protected from tampering. Through the use of robust verification methods, like two-factor authentication, companies can validate the signer's identity, reducing the risk of fraud.

In addition, E-Sign APIs often provide audit logs that track all actions performed on a file. This aspect is crucial for adherence to standards like the ESIGN Act and the Uniform Electronic Transactions Act (UETA). Enterprises can establish alignment with compliance frameworks, confirming that executed documents remain legally valid and enforceable.

Key Trends in E-Sign Technology for 2026

As businesses continue to emphasize security and regulatory adherence via e-signature APIs, the electronic signature landscape is changing at a rapid pace. Throughout 2026, a number of key trends are influencing this technology. AI is being more widely incorporated into electronic signature platforms, enhancing user experience by automating tasks such as document verification and personalized user interactions. Moreover, blockchain technology is gaining traction, providing immutable records of transactions and increasing trust in e-signatures.

A further important trend is the rise of mobile-centric technologies, permitting users to complete document signing smoothly on different devices. This transition serves an expanding distributed workforce, streamlining processes across different platforms. Furthermore, improved biometric identification systems are being integrated, additionally strengthening overall security. As the demand for efficient, secure signing solutions grows, companies must align with these changes to maintain their edge and ensure adherence in an evolving regulatory landscape.
